    Mari Selvraj's third movie ranks third in his offerings so far

    Maamanan A review by Rajesh Puvvada

    Mari Selvraj once again paints caste based strokes on a culturally stigmatic canvas!! After pariyerumal and Karnan, he used the same starting ritual, which is to have a hound killed or slaughtered!! This time it got a little predictable.

    Casting Vadivelu as the protagonist in a realistic appearance gives great strength to this movie. After a long hiatus, we could witness a larger screen presence of this seasoned actor. I enjoyed every bit of his performance largely. The maturity in which he handles his character tells us how strongly he lived into it.

    At the very beginning of the movie when the titles were coming up there was a huge applause when the name of Fahad Fazil came up. He definitely raised the bar of his own best performance. Every move if his was unique and natural.

    I am not going to mention any one from the caste because their roles or performances were not pivotal or palpable.

    Years of stigma around the lower and higher castes dominate our rich social fabric and that is well brought out in this movie. Honestly, the true value of this movie was delivered right at the time of intermission. What ever came out from Mark Selvraj after the interval had lesser value plot wise. The plot got diluted into a political portion that stinks. However the end state was very well handled. Many directors these days suffer to handle the crispness of a fine plot for a longer duration. Presenting something solid for a longer duration requires great degree of detail and an emotional grip. The way Mari Selavaraj held our emotions firm around Pariyerum Perumal and Karnan is felt well because he did not hold it well in this movie. Especially in the second half.

    Red giant wanted a platform to put its political agenda forward and the second half was a gift to red giant by Mari Selvraj.

    A R Rehamans score jelled well with the movie but I think, no tune or a BGM or a song is playing repeatedly in my head after watching the movie. Which means the musical manifest of this movie evaporated very quickly.

    Given the movie did not employ any illogical parts this movie holds water on a thin paper cup. Without the protagonist and the antagonist performances the movie would have lost its worth.

    I recommend a one time viewing with family. And, I am going with a 7.5/10. You can also wait for it to come on OTT.

    What worked for Pariyerum Perumaal & Karnan was it was more grounded in reality. It was relatable, I was able to sympathize with the director's view. It felt like some dialogues were intentionally planted for Udhayanidhi's gain. The film felt too dramatic & lost the touch of reality. Casting Fahadh only added more to it. He did deliver what he was paid for, but I just couldn't see him as his given role. At times, the pacing feels slightly uneven, with certain scenes dragging on longer than necessary. Also Keerthy suresh was not justified. Felt like she was there just for the sake of having a female lead.
